We travelled as a family of 5 booked via Heidi and stayed in a 3 bed apartment (one bedroom is described as a sleeping nook but it is a smallish room with bunk beds). The apartment was tired and in distinct need of modernisation, the showers and kitchen sink were grotty, it was quite cold compared to all the other ski accommodation we’ve stayed at in France and the drains smelled. The hotel building itself is in need of modernisation, lifts, hallways and staircases are grotty, and the ski locker rooms in the cellars are awful! The floors around the lockers were flooded and filthy so if you went down in crocs for example your socks were wet and dirty straight away. On a plus point the folks in the very convenient onsite SKISET hire/shop were great, my boots were super comfy all week. The Aime 2000 commercial area itself isn’t great, it’s tired and lacks atmosphere of any kind. There are public lifts and underground walkways to get you from the Hauts Bois building up to the big ‘ship’ shaped commercial building where all the shops/restaurants/Spar supermarket is located. These are filthy and reminded me of the stairwells of car parks in the UK that are dark, dingy, worrying to use as a woman alone, and smell of wee. And the route back to the hotel from the lowest lift is unlit. Restaurant La Terrasse was great for a family evening meal, friendly staff, a lovely fondu for 2, good burgers and a duck daily special that my teenager devoured. The skiing around La Plagne is great and we’ll be back but definitely in a different area and in better accommodation.

Really pleased with these apartments which were also a very good price. Booked a 2-bed but the bunk beds in the alcove made it a 3-bed which was perfect for our teenagers (1 boy, 1 girl) so they didn't have to share a room. Main bedroom has an ensuite so 2 showers in the apartment was also a bonus. Compared to other ski apartments we found it to be very spacious. Balcony overlooking the Golf run and the mountains was beautiful. Great location - out of the boot room straight onto the slopes. Despite being at the edge of La Plagne we easily made it over to Les Arcs on 2 days. The Spar shop, restaurants and bars are an easy couple of minutes walk. Bread delivery service was delicious, convenient and good value. Staff were friendly and helpful. Terrasse bar was a great location for an apres-ski drink at the end of the skiing day. Kitchen was basic but after a day's skiing that is all you need. Lockers aren't heated so we brought our ski boots up to the apartments and kept them in the very warm and spacious bathroom. Not a problem. Yes, the apartments are a bit tired in terms of decor but given the price this shouldn't be a surprise. Husband and boy-child used the steam room and sauna a couple of times - dressing gowns provided in the apartments were a nice surprise. For the price, I could not fault this place. Spacious, great location and convenient for the slopes and other amenities.

My 9yo daughter and I stayed here in Dec 23. If you arrive in Plagne Centre and get the Telemetro to Aime 2000 then it's a short walk to the P&V building but not exactly intuitive. Basically walk all the way round from the Telemetro to the lifts opposite the viewing gallery and go down. Then walk ahead and get the next lift down. Finally, walk ahead again and get the last lift down. Turn left on exit and you can walk to the ground floor reception of the P&V building. Firstly, checking in online before we arrived helped speed up the process dramatically. Our ski passes were ready to collect and our ready-made meals from partner Famileat were already in the fridge in our room! These were very good quality and I would endorse the Cottage Pie and Parmentier (duck) pie. All the check in staff were incredibly friendly, helpful and spoke great english. Every day we utilised the boulangerie ordering service and collected our fresh baguettes and pastries from reception at 8am. Ski in ski out was perfect for us and you end up on the Golf run which is great for warming up and gives you a choice of 3 directions to head off in every morning. You can head down to Plagne 1800 and then back up towards Bergerie. Or you can head straight to Centre and choose Lovatiere, Colorado or the Cabin or finally you can head down towards Montalbert. Lockable lockers are provided and we came back most days at lunch. The rooms are nice but cosy and I wouldn't like to be at full occupancy! We had just one adult and one child in our 5 bed room. A family of two adults and two kids would be fine but anything more and you better be happy living in close proximity! The room is well equipped and has dishwasher and fancy microwave oven. Would recommend bringing a USB stick you can plug into the TV for Netflix etc. Wifi was available. A cleaning kit was provided with some dishwasher tabs, cloths and tea towels. The checkout process requires you to clean the kitchen prior to check out. The rooms were eventually nice and warm but we there on opening weekend so took a bit of time to heat up the room as radiators had obviously been turned off over summer. In fact, they got too warm as then had to open a window! The pool and spa is nice with great views but could do with being a bit warmer! Maybe this too needed to warm up a bit. There was a gym that I didn't have time to use. For hire there is a skiset onsite or an Intersport in the adjacent building. In the adjacent building you will also find a supermarket, a takeaway sushi place (highly recommend!), and the normal shops, restaurants and bars. I would happily return here again in the future and hope to do so or maybe visit another P&V place. We used Ben's bus for airport transfer (see other reviews!).

Descripción del alojamiento

  • N.º de habitaciones: 93
Si decides alojarte en Résidence Pierre & Vacances Premium Les Hauts Bois de Aime, estarás cerca de remontes de esquí, a solo unos pasos de Estación de esquí La Plagne y a apenas 10 min a pie de Estación de esquí Aime 2000. Además, este residence para familias se encuentra a 18,9 km de Les Arcs y a 33,6 km de Estación de esquí Peisey-Vallandry.

Para un relax sin igual, nada como una visita al spa, que ofrece masajes. Además del acceso directo a las pistas de esquí, este residence ofrece un centro de bienestar y una piscina cubierta.

Tendrás periódicos gratuitos en el vestíbulo, consigna de equipaje y una lavandería a tu disposición. Hay un aparcamiento sin asistencia (de pago) disponible.

Reserva una de las 93 habitaciones con minicocina, frigorífico y horno, y disfruta de una estancia inolvidable. Las habitaciones disponen de balcón. La conexión wifi gratis te mantendrá en contacto con los tuyos. Además, podrás disfrutar de canales por satélite. Entre las comodidades, se incluyen caja fuerte, periódicos gratuitos y teléfono.
